Red Exotic Flowers of the Garden, Victorian Botanical Illustration
Very Rare, Beautifully Illustrated Antique Engraved Victorian Botanical Illustration of Red Exotic Flowers of the Garden: Plate 55, from The Book of Practical Botany in Word and Image (Lehrbuch der praktischen Pflanzenkunde in Wort und Bild), Published in 1886. FSC real wood frame with double mounted 10x8 print. Double mounted with white conservation mountboard. Frame moulding comprises stained composite natural wood veneers (Finger Jointed Pine) 39mm wide by 21mm thick. Archival quality Fujifilm CA photo paper mounted onto 1mm card. Overall outside dimensions are 17x15 inches (431x381mm). Rear features Framing tape to cover staples, 50mm Hanger plate, cork bumpers. Glazed with durable thick 2mm Acrylic to provide a virtually unbreakable glass-like finish. Acrylic Glass is far safer, more flexible and much lighter than typical mineral glass. Moreover, its higher translucency makes it a perfect carrier for photo prints. Acrylic allows a little more light to penetrate the surface than conventional glass and absorbs UV rays so that the image and the picture quality doesn't suffer under direct sunlight even after many years. This beautifully illustrated antique print showcases the vibrant and rare red exotic flowers of the garden, captured in a Victorian botanical illustration. Taken from "The Book of Practical Botany in Word and Image" published in 1886, this artwork is a true testament to the intricate beauty of nature. Digitally restored to its former glory, this enchanting piece transports us back to a time when botanical illustrations were highly valued for their scientific accuracy and artistic finesse. The hand-colored design brings out the rich hues and delicate details of each flower, making them come alive on the page. From peonies to chrysanthemums, sage to clover, this composition features an array of uncultivated blooms that add an air of wildness and natural charm. Each stem, leaf, petal, and blossom has been meticulously engraved with precision and care.
